Understanding Spinal Decompression Remedy: A Comprehensive Guide
Spinal decompression therapy has emerged as a preferred non-invasive treatment option for individuals suffering from various backbone-related conditions. This comprehensive guide aims to delve into the intricacies of spinal decompression therapy, shedding light on its mechanisms, benefits, effectiveness, and considerations.
Understanding Spinal Decompression Therapy:
What's Spinal Decompression Remedy?
Spinal decompression remedy is a non-surgical treatment aimed at relieving back and neck pain caused by conditions similar to herniated discs, degenerative disc disease, sciatica, and spinal stenosis. The therapy involves gently stretching the spine to alleviate pressure on the spinal discs and promote the healing of injured or damaged tissues.
How Does Spinal Decompression Work?
Spinal decompression remedy employs traction strategies to elongate the spine and create negative pressure within the intervertebral discs. This negative pressure can facilitate the retraction or repositioning of herniated or bulging discs, thereby reducing compression on spinal nerves and promoting the inflow of oxygen, water, and nutrients into the discs for healing.
Types of Spinal Decompression Therapy:
a. Mechanical Spinal Decompression: This includes the usage of specialized equipment similar to traction tables or decompression machines to apply controlled traction to the spine.
b. Manual Spinal Decompression: Manual methods performed by chiropractors or physical therapists contain palms-on manipulation to gently stretch and decompress the spine.
c. Inversion Remedy: Inversion tables are utilized to hold upside down, allowing gravity to decompress the spine and alleviate pressure on the discs.
Benefits of Spinal Decompression Remedy:
a. Pain Relief: By reducing pressure on spinal nerves and promoting disc healing, spinal decompression therapy can successfully alleviate chronic back and neck pain.
b. Improved Mobility: Reduction from pain and pressure can enhance mobility and flexibility, enabling individuals to perform each day activities with better ease.
c. Non-invasive Different: Unlike surgical interventions, spinal decompression therapy is non-invasive and typically associated with minimal risks and side effects.
d. Potential Avoidance of Surgery: In some cases, spinal decompression remedy might assist individuals keep away from the necessity for surgical procedures to address backbone-related issues.
Effectiveness of Spinal Decompression Remedy:
While research on the effectiveness of spinal decompression remedy is ongoing, many individuals report significant improvements in pain and function following treatment. Clinical studies have demonstrated promising outcomes, particularly for conditions reminiscent of herniated discs and sciatica. However, the efficacy of spinal decompression therapy could differ depending on factors such as the underlying condition, individual health standing, and adherence to treatment protocols.
Considerations Before Undergoing Spinal Decompression Remedy:
a. Session with Healthcare Provider: It's essential to seek the advice of with a qualified healthcare provider, akin to a chiropractor or spine specialist, to determine if spinal decompression therapy is suitable to your condition.
b. Treatment Expectations: Understanding the potential benefits and limitations of spinal decompression therapy might help manage expectations and make informed decisions.
c. Contraindications: Sure medical conditions, akin to extreme osteoporosis, spinal fractures, or being pregnant, might contraindicate spinal decompression therapy. It's crucial to discuss any undermendacity health concerns with your healthcare provider.
d. Treatment Period and Frequency: The recommended period and frequency of spinal decompression periods may differ based mostly on individual wants and treatment response.
